ACTION REQUIRED: Update your Bitbucket Cloud SSH Host Keys

Hello Bitbucket Cloud users, We recently learned that encrypted copies of Bitbucket’s SSH host keys were included in a data breach of a third-party credential management vendor. The SSH protocol uses host keys to establish the identity of a trusted server for every SSH connection, like when a git pull establishes a SSH connection to […]

New IP addresses for Bitbucket Cloud

Note: In July 2024 we published a follow-up to this post. It includes updates to the list of IP addresses, as well as to the rollout timing. We will be gradually migrating traffic to use new IP addresses for bitbucket.org from August 2023. The migration is expected to be completed by the end of October. […]
